Join Patrick Dempsey, Tom Danielson and The Ranch at Live Oak for the Ride of Your Life

By Pardhasaradhi Gonuguntla

Malibu, California—Reported By Elite Traveler, the private jet lifestyle magazine

Twenty Twenty (T20) Cycling LLC announces that Emmy-nominated actor and avid cyclist Patrick Dempsey and veteran Pro-Cyclist, Tom Danielson, will host an all-inclusive, week-long cycling camp at the renowned fitness retreat, The Ranch at Live Oak / Malibu. This educational and action-packed week offers a limited number of cycling enthusiasts the opportunity to experience the life of a pro athlete and learn how to improve their own performance in the sport.

Running from January 20 – 26, the daily program, which is limited to 16 guests, will include fully supported rides, nutritionally prepared meals by industry experts, daily massages, and fitness and nutrition program advice/consultation along with private accommodations. This intimate experience will also allow for riders to receive personal interaction with both Dempsey and Danielson during their six night stay.

“Tom and I are extremely excited to create a whole new type of cycling experience.” said Dempsey. “The Ranch at Live Oak is the perfect setting to have an unforgettable week riding, relaxing, and learning how to improve both on and off the bike—all while benefiting youth cycling and the future of this great sport. I’m just hoping I can keep up with our guests!”

To ensure riders have the ultimate experience, T20 Cycling has teamed up with industry leaders Specialized and Garmin to provide pro caliber equipment. Each cyclist will receive their own personal Garmin Edge GPS cycling computer to track and record their rides. With a total 400 miles to be covered over the week, moderate or advanced fitness is recommended but not required.

“The roads around Malibu have become one of my favorite places to train.” said Danielson. “You can ride all day on perfect roads with mountains on one side and ocean on the other with very little traffic. Patrick and I are excited to share this area, help others get a jump-start on their 2013 cycling and fitness goals and give back to the future of cycling.”

This exclusive camp will benefit youth cycling and promote fitness and wellness to the youth though the sport of cycling. The week-long program will be offered at an all-inclusive rate of $8,000 with 10% of proceeds being donated to various youth charities.
